The Los Altos Stage Company's 19th anniversary season opens with a caustic musical fable ripe with adultery, hysterical pregnancy, strippers, murderous ex-boyfriends, Costco, and the Ice Capades. The Great American Trailer Park Musical opens tonight, September 4 and runs through September 28 at the Bus Barn Theater in Los Altos.

Foothill Music Theatre presents the Pulitzer Prize-winning comedy HOW TO SUCCEED IN BUSINESS WITHOUT REALLY TRYING, directed by Jay Manley, with musical direction by Catherine Snider and choreography by Dottie Lester-White. With score and lyrics by Frank Loesser, book by Abe Burrows, Jack Weinstock and Willie Gilbert, HOW TO SUCCEED IN BUSINESS WITHOUT REALLY TRYING plays tonight, July 20 - August 12, 2012 at the Smithwick Theatre at Foothill College in Los Altos. For tickets ($10-$28) and information, the public may visit www.foothillmusicals.com, or call the box office at (650) 949-7360. BroadwayWorld has a sneak peek at the production photos below.

Multi-award winning Foothill Music Theatre presents the timely musical WORKING. Based on Pulitzer Prize-winning author Studs Terkel's best-selling book of interviews with American workers, WORKING is directed by Milissa Carey with music direction by Mark Hanson and choreography by Michael Ryken.

Bay Area residents have eight opportunities to feel the rejuvenating effects of Fountain of Youth, the refreshing new musical comedy by Bay Area librettist RC Staab and Boston composer Jeff Pflaumbaum. Fountain of Youth runs at the historic Hoover Theatre in San Jose in an expanded workshop production.
